发明名称 Circumferential laser crawler
摘要 An automated motorized assembly may be utilized to move a laser reflector on inside or outside surfaces, along edges of barrel shape structures. The laser reflector may be used to reflect laser signals back to a laser tracker metrology system locked in on the laser reflector. The laser tracker may follow the laser reflector as it moves along an edge of a barrel shape structure, acquiring circumferential data. The laser reflector may be moved to different positions to enable obtaining different circumferential rows of data. The automated motorized assembly may comprise a movement component that ensures consistent, continued, and/or tight movement along the traversed edge. The movement component may comprise a plurality of wheels and/or rollers, and one or more motors for driving at least some of the wheels and/or rollers. The automated motorized assembly may be controlled by user input, which may be communicated wirelessly.

An apparatus, comprising: an automated motorized device operable to run along a curvilinear shaped edge of a structure to acquire circumferential coordinate data, the automated motorized device comprising: a movement component operable to move the automated motorized device along the curvilinear shaped edge of the structure, the movement component comprising a first roller mechanism and a second roller mechanism;a clamping structure operable to movably secure the automated motorized device about the curvilinear shaped edge, the clamping structure comprising a first clamping arm, a second clamping arm, and an intermediate support coupled between the first clamping arm and the second clamping arm, wherein the first clamping arm operably supports the first roller mechanism in contact with a first side of the structure and the second clamping arm operably supports the second roller mechanism in contact with a second side of the structure, wherein the second side is opposite the first side, wherein the intermediate support engages the curvilinear shaped edge of the structure, the curvilinear shaped edge extending between the first side and second side of the structure; anda reflector that is operable to reflect signals back to a source of the signals.
